Knowledge Levels of Nursing Students Regarding Latex Allergy

Özet (Abstract)

Objective: The present study aims to determine the level of knowledge regarding latex allergy among nursing students. Methods: The sample of this descriptive study consists of 171 nursing students enrolled in a university. Data were collected using a Demographic Information Form and a Latex Allergy Knowledge Form. Whether the data were normally distributed was determined using the Kolmogorov-Smirnov and Shapiro-Wilk tests. In cases where the data showed normal distribution, the ANOVA test was used to compare the test scores of more than two groups. The Post Hoc Scheffe test was used to determine significant differences. The Mann-Whitney U test was used to compare the test scores of binary groups. Results: Participants’ mean total score on the latex allergy knowledge form was 32.36±4.20, and considering the self-reports, 5.8% of students had a latex allergy. There was a significant difference in latex allergy knowledge scores among participants based on the classes they were attending (p=0.022). In the study, 85.4% of students were aware of the higher risk of allergic reactions due to wearing latex gloves among healthcare workers. The percentage of participants who that disposable gloves contain latex was 87.7%. It was found that students had misconceptions in some questions regarding latex-containing products, allergy symptoms, potential problematic foods, and treatment-prevention methods, with error rates reaching up to 75%. Conclusions: It is essential to develop educational programs to increase awareness of latex allergy in laboratory and hospital settings within the undergraduate nursing curriculum. Conducting screenings for latex allergy, particularly among first-year students, is particularly important to ensure employee safety. Faculties should take necessary measures to provide a safe learning environment for students, including those with latex allergies. Moreover, educational conditions should be adapted to accommodate students with latex allergies.
